Who needs each restricted stock unit?

01
Restricted stock units are typically provided to employees as part of their compensation package.
02
They are commonly used by public companies to incentivize and retain key employees.
03
Executives, managers, and other employees who contribute significantly to the company's success often receive restricted stock units.
04
These units are designed to align the interests of employees with those of the shareholders and increase loyalty and commitment.
05
